#Define simulation verification#

Verification is necessary but not sufficient for validation, that is a model may be verified but not valid. Verification is the process of ensuring that the model behaves as intended, usually by debugging or through animation.

Choices range from general purpose languages such as fortran or simulation programs such as Arena. The model is translated into programming language. For example, the arrival rate of a specific part to the manufacturing plant may follow a normal distribution curve. Data is fitted to theoretical distributions. New data is collected and/or existing data is gathered. Creating a flow chart of how the system operates facilitates the understanding of what variables are involved and how these variables interact.Īfter formulating the model, the type of data to collect is determined. Understanding how the actual system behaves and determining the basic requirements of the model are necessary in developing the right model.

Often the system is very complex, thus defining the system requires an experienced simulator who can find the appropriate level of detail and flexibility. This step involves identifying the system components to be modeled and the preformance measures to be analyzed. This schedule is necessary to determine if sufficient time and resources are available for completion. Milestones are indicated for tracking progress. The tasks for completing the project are broken down into work packages with a responsible party assigned to each package. Care should be taken to determine if simulation is the appropriate tool for the problem under investigation. The problem is further defined through objective observations of the process to be studied. The initial step involves defining the goals of the study and determing what needs to be solved. The following briefly describes the basic steps in the simulation process : Regardless of the type of problem and the objective of the study, the process by which the simulation is performed remains constant. The application of simulation involves specific steps in order for the simulation study to be successful.
